    More Good News | Building a Safer, Stronger Downtown

    (COLLINGWOOD and THE BLUE MOUNTAINS, ON) The Collingwood and The Blue Mountains Detachment of the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) recently created the Community Engagement and Enforcement Team (CEET) initiative to increase police presence and proactive community engagement by enhancing foot and bicycle patrols in the downtown core of Collingwood, Thornbury and the Blue Mountain Village.

    During those patrols officers will engage with businesses owners/employees and members of the public and in doing so will be a proactive presence creating a positive experience for individuals visiting the targeted locations.

    The Collingwood/The Blue Mountains OPP partnered with key stakeholders in Collingwood, Thornbury and the Blue Mountain Village to identify priorities and create collaborative solutions to theft and violent crime incidents which can take a toll on the vitality and safety in downtown core and impact local businesses and community confidence.

    Through a successful application to the Provincial Priorities Funding Stream of the 2025-26 Community Safety and Policing (CSP) grant, we are launching a multi-faceted initiative to:

    Build a sustainable, community driven crime reduction strategy rooted in collaboration and shared responsibility, one that would improve safety and community confidence focusing on regular foot patrol, bicycle patrol, Crime Prevention Through Environmental Design (CPTED) and the enhancement of proactive community policing.

    Guided by data and community input, these efforts aim to reduce crime, enhance public safety, and restore a vibrant downtown for businesses, residents, and visitors alike.

    Together, we can make our community safer.
